Villa Muggia
Why it's perfect for your celebration: Villa Muggia is exceptionally well-suited for your specific needs and budget.
Capacity & Layout - Perfect Match
Historic villa interior: Accommodates up to 80 guests (perfect for your 60)
Four elegant rooms with intricate period details
Open-air terrace: Ideal for aperitifs with lake views
Secular garden space: Beautiful ceremony setting for up to 150 guests
Marquee option: LED-lit covered space in the gardens

Budget Breakdown for Your 60-Guest Celebration
Realistic €40,000-50,000 Allocation:
Saturday Wedding:
Venue (Villa Muggia): €8,000-12,000
Catering (60 guests x €80-120): €4,800-7,200
Photography: €4,000-5,000
Flowers & Decor: €2,000-3,500
Music/DJ: €1,500-2,500
Day-of Coordinator: €1,500-2,500
Transportation/Extras: €2,000-3,000
Church ceremony costs: €500-1,000
Friday Night Pizza Party:
Venue & Food (60 guests x €50-80): €3,000-4,800
Karaoke/Entertainment: €500-1,000
Total Estimated Range: €36,800-52,500
Your €40,000-50,000 budget is perfectly aligned with realistic Lake Maggiore wedding costs.
